cd560926bd Merge pull request #36889 from wojtek-t/reuse_fields_and_labels
Automatic merge from submit-queue

Reuse fields and labels

This should significantly reduce memory allocations in apiserver in large cluster.
Explanation:
- every kubelet is refreshing watch every 5-10 minutes (this generally is not causing relist - it just renews watch)
- that means, in 5000-node cluster, we are issuing ~10 watches per second
- since we don't have "watch heartbets", the watch is issued from previously received resourceVersion
- to make some assumption, let's assume pods are evenly spread across pods, and writes for them are evenly spread - that means, that a given kubelet is interested in 1 per 5000 pod changes
- with that assumption, each watch, has to process 2500 (on average) previous watch events
- for each of such even, we are currently computing fields.

This PR is fixing this problem.

7d14b568c3 Merge pull request #36001 from smarterclayton/change_double_decode
Automatic merge from submit-queue

Avoid double decoding all client responses

Fixes #35982 

The linked issue uncovered that we were always double decoding the response in restclient for get, list, update, create, and patch.  That's fairly expensive, most especially for list.  This PR refines the behavior of the rest client to avoid double decoding, and does so while minimizing the changes to rest client consumers.

restclient must be able to deal with multiple types of servers. Alter the behavior of restclient.Result#Raw() to not process the body on error, but instead to return the generic error (which still matches the error checking cases in api/error like IsBadRequest). If the caller uses
.Error(), .Into(), or .Get(), try decoding the body as a Status.

For older servers, continue to default apiVersion "v1" when calling restclient.Result#Error(). This was only for 1.1 servers and the extensions group, which we have since fixed.

This removes a double decode of very large objects (like LIST) - we were trying to DecodeInto status, but that ends up decoding the entire result and then throwing it away.  This makes the decode behavior specific to the type of action the user wants.

```release-note
The error handling behavior of `pkg/client/restclient.Result` has changed.  Calls to `Result.Raw()` will no longer parse the body, although they will still return errors that react to `pkg/api/errors.Is*()` as in previous releases.  Callers of `Get()` and `Into()` will continue to receive errors that are parsed from the body if the kind and apiVersion of the body match the `Status` object.

This more closely aligns rest client as a generic RESTful client, while preserving the special Kube API extended error handling for the `Get` and `Into` methods (which most Kube clients use).
```

Kubernetes Submit Queue
d187997c94 Merge pull request #32386 from liggitt/anonymous-authenticated-groups
Automatic merge from submit-queue

Allow anonymous API server access, decorate authenticated users with system:authenticated group

When writing authorization policy, it is often necessary to allow certain actions to any authenticated user. For example, creating a service or configmap, and granting read access to all users

It is also frequently necessary to allow actions to any unauthenticated user. For example, fetching discovery APIs might be part of an authentication process, and therefore need to be able to be read without access to authentication credentials.

This PR:
* Adds an option to allow anonymous requests to the secured API port. If enabled, requests to the secure port that are not rejected by other configured authentication methods are treated as anonymous requests, and given a username of `system:anonymous` and a group of `system:unauthenticated`. Note: this should only be used with an `--authorization-mode` other than `AlwaysAllow`
* Decorates user.Info returned from configured authenticators with the group `system:authenticated`.

This is related to defining a default set of roles and bindings for RBAC (https://github.com/kubernetes/features/issues/2). The bootstrap policy should allow all users (anonymous or authenticated) to request the discovery APIs.

```release-note
kube-apiserver learned the '--anonymous-auth' flag, which defaults to true. When enabled, requests to the secure port that are not rejected by other configured authentication methods are treated as anonymous requests, and given a username of 'system:anonymous' and a group of 'system:unauthenticated'. 

Authenticated users are decorated with a 'system:authenticated' group.

NOTE: anonymous access is enabled by default. If you rely on authentication alone to authorize access, change to use an authorization mode other than AlwaysAllow, or or set '--anonymous-auth=false'.
```

Tim Hockin
7efb2d4738 Always emit autoConvert funcs, but call for help
Previously we refused to emit 'autoConvert_*' functions if any field was not
convertible.  The way around this was to write manual Conversion functions, but
to do so safely you must handle every fields.  Huge opportunity for errors.

This PR cleans up the filtering such that it only operates on types that should
be converted (remove a lot of code) and tracks when fields are skipped.  In
that case, it emits an 'autoConvert' function but not a public 'Convert'
function.  If there is no manual function, the compile will fail.

This also means that manual conversion functions can call autoConvert functions
and then "patch up" what they need.

Kubernetes Submit Queue
f53a35fb76 Merge pull request #29147 from caesarxuchao/cut-client-repo-staging
Automatic merge from submit-queue

Cut the client repo, staging it in the main repo

Tracking issue: #28559
ref: https://github.com/kubernetes/kubernetes/pull/25978#issuecomment-232710174

This PR implements the plan a few of us came up with last week for cutting client into its own repo:
1. creating "_staging" (name is tentative) directory in the main repo, using a script to copy the client and its dependencies to this directory
2. periodically publishing the contents of this staging client to k8s.io/client-go repo
3. converting k8s components in the main repo to use the staged client. They should import the staged client as if the client were vendored. (i.e., the import line should be `import "k8s.io/client-go/<pacakge name>`). This requirement is to ease step 4.
4. In the future, removing the staging area, and vendoring the real client-go repo.

The advantage of having the staging area is that we can continuously run integration/e2e tests with the latest client repo and the latest main repo, without waiting for the client repo to be vendored back into the main repo. This staging area will exist until our test matrix is vendoring both the client and the server.

In the above plan, the tricky part is step 3. This PR achieves it by creating a symlink under ./vendor, pointing to the staging area, so packages in the main repo can refer to the client repo as if it's vendored. To prevent the godep tool from messing up the staging area, we export the staged client to GOPATH in hack/godep-save.sh so godep will think the client packages are local and won't attempt to manage ./vendor/k8s.io/client-go.

This is a POC. We'll rearrange the directory layout of the client before merge.

4466531382 Merge pull request #29094 from luxas/gomaxproc
Automatic merge from submit-queue

Remove GOMAXPROCS() calls because they are unnecessary


Now we're setting GOMAXPROCS when every binary starts up, but we don't have to do that anymore, since we've upgraded to Go 1.6

Documentation for it:

> func GOMAXPROCS(n int) int

> GOMAXPROCS sets the maximum number of CPUs that can be executing simultaneously and returns the previous setting. If n < 1, it does not change the current setting. The number of logical CPUs on the local machine can be queried with NumCPU. This call will go away when the scheduler improves. 

A simple program to prove it's unnecessary:

```go
package main
import (
    "fmt"
    "runtime"
)
func main(){
    numCPUBefore := runtime.GOMAXPROCS(runtime.NumCPU())
    numCPUAfter := runtime.GOMAXPROCS(runtime.NumCPU())
    fmt.Println(numCPUBefore, numCPUAfter)
}
```

Output with Go 1.4.2: `1 4`
Output with Go 1.6.2: `4 4`

So I think we should remove calls to GOMAXPROCS now, and it should be pretty straightforward

Clayton Coleman
e0ebcf4216
Split the storage and negotiation parts of Codecs
The codec factory should support two distinct interfaces - negotiating
for a serializer with a client, vs reading or writing data to a storage
form (etcd, disk, etc). Make the EncodeForVersion and DecodeToVersion
methods only take Encoder and Decoder, and slight refactoring elsewhere.

In the storage factory, use a content type to control what serializer to
pick, and use the universal deserializer. This ensures that storage can
read JSON (which might be from older objects) while only writing
protobuf. Add exceptions for those resources that may not be able to
write to protobuf (specifically third party resources, but potentially
others in the future).
